Evaluating Mobile Site Performance: Tools and Metrics
Evaluating mobile site performance is a crucial step in any comprehensive SEO audit. To get an accurate picture, digital marketers leverage a suite of tools and metrics specifically designed for mobile environments. Google Search Console and Google Analytics offer detailed insights into how users interact with your site on smartphones and tablets, providing data on bounce rates, time spent on page, and device-specific search queries. These analytics help identify areas where mobile optimization is needed, such as slow loading times or content that’s not readily accessible on smaller screens.
Beyond these platforms, specialized SEO tools like PageSpeed Insights, Mobile-Friendly Test, and Lighthouse provide technical assessments of your site’s mobile performance. They offer actionable recommendations to improve page speed, enhance usability, and ensure your site is optimized for the latest mobile standards. By combining these tools and metrics, you can conduct a thorough SEO audit tailored to the unique demands of the mobile landscape.

Technical SEO Checkpoints for Mobile Websites
A comprehensive SEO audit for mobile websites should start with a thorough review of technical checkpoints. These include ensuring your site is fully responsive, with a fluid layout that adapts to different screen sizes and orientations. Mobile-specific elements like touch gestures, fast loading speeds, and seamless navigation are also crucial. Google’s Mobile-Friendly Test can quickly identify issues with page layout, tap targets, and overall usability on mobile devices.
Additionally, check for proper schema markup implementation, which helps search engines understand your content better. Mobile sites should also have a secure connection (HTTPS) to protect user data and improve trustworthiness. Optimizing meta tags, including unique and descriptive titles and descriptions, is essential for both SEO and enhancing the user experience on mobile platforms.
User Experience (UX) Considerations for Mobile SEO
A successful mobile SEO strategy can’t overlook the importance of User Experience (UX). As a significant component of any comprehensive SEO audit, evaluating and optimizing UX ensures that your website is not only discovered by mobile users but also provides them with a seamless, intuitive navigation experience. Consider the speed of loading times on various devices; slow sites lead to high bounce rates, negatively impacting rankings. Responsive design, where a single site adapts to different screen sizes, is crucial for both user satisfaction and search engine algorithms that favor mobile-friendly pages.
Furthermore, mobile users expect easy access to essential information through well-structured content, clear call-to-action buttons, and minimal loading screens. Optimizing for touch interactions, ensuring tap targets are large enough, and simplifying complex forms can significantly enhance UX. Regularly testing your site across different models, operating systems, and network conditions will help identify and address any usability issues, ultimately driving better engagement and higher conversion rates—all vital factors in a robust mobile SEO audit.
